    What a fantastic discovery! This place has its own parking lot, a rarity that deserves major kudos! As you step inside, you're warmly greeted with bright smiles and the irresistible aroma of freshly baked pizza. The atmosphere is very clean, well-organized, and spacious, with about 7 tables for seating , bar table with bar stool for enjoying a meal. You can also grab a pizza to go or savor a slice at the bar. Selling by the slice is my absolute favorite! The beverage selection is impressive, featuring a soda machine, varied canned and bottled drinks, and even free water and beer on tap. But the true pièce de résistance is the mouthwatering pizza that will leave you craving more. Having spent seven years on the East Coast, I can confidently say that this pizza reminds me of the best of New York City places like Scarr's. The crust and sauce are absolute perfection. Pagliacci Pizza is a game-changer, and I'm eager to return and try more of their incredible pizza, including their pizza of the day menu. Will I be back? Absolutely! Oh and they also get 5 Star for customer service! The lady the helped us today was so nice and friendly.

    Laura G.

    The restaurant is nice and they have plenty of seating available inside. The staff seem nice and the service was quite quick. If you order by slice from the counter, they pop it in the oven to heat it up for you before serving. Original Cheese: I do really like how crispy the crust is and how warm it came out of the oven. The cheese was warm and gooey which was lovely. However, there is way too much crust in relation to cheese/sauce. I could taste mostly crust, and very little of the cheese/sauce itself. For a $4+ slice of pizza, I definitely had higher standards for what this slice of pizza would be like, which it did not meet.

But though it is my favorite place by far to have pizza, I have a bone to pick about one of the servers (most of their servers are fine): As a former fine dining restaurant server and shift manager, I'm familiar with the Washington state law that allows restaurant patrons to take partially consumed bottles of wine home with them in their cars if (a) it is resealed with its cork, and (b) they keep it in the trunk or other cargo area where humans don't normally sit. And don't touch it until they're parked at home. I'm a light drinker, and one time I only drank about half a bottle of beer. I think it might have been a large bottle, I'm not sure. Wondering if the rule I knew so well for wine might apply to beer bottles too, I asked the server if it was possible to take it home. I supposed that the main issue might be whether they had a way to seal it, since the cap was no longer good for that. He didn't know, and said he'd find out. When he returned, he said no, and acted like it was the dumbest question anyone in the universe had ever asked, or ever could ask. I had a flashback of Dixie's BBQ on Northup way by I-405 (long closed), where surly sarcasm from knuckle-dragging employees was basically a brand. Curious, today I asked Google for help. I learned that the reason it's possible with wine is because there is a special carve-out in Washington state law just for wine. The carve-out does not apply to any other type of alcohol. So it doesn't matter if you can find a way to reseal the beer bottle. Because the carve-out is only for wine, not beer. I doubt that nuance is widely known. I think it's a reasonable question.
